Meta AI is getting a Mac app

Meta introduced a new macOS application centered on its artificial intelligence chatbot on Wednesday, expanding the company’s efforts to position its AI as a productivity tool. The app allows users to share windows with the chatbot, which can offer recommendations, answer inquiries, and generate content based on visible screen content. Additionally, the application includes dictation functionality that works across all Mac applications.

The development reflects Meta’s broader strategy to enhance its AI assistant to more directly compete with established competitors in the desktop AI space. Google’s Gemini AI already offers a Mac app with window-sharing capabilities, while OpenAI’s ChatGPT and Anthropic’s Claude have advanced further by permitting their chatbots to directly control user computers.

Concurrently with the app launch, Meta announced expanded capabilities designed for business and creator accounts. The chatbot is now integrated with Facebook and Instagram accounts, Meta’s advertising campaigns, and Google Workspace across web, mobile, and Mac platforms.

The enhanced features enable businesses to leverage the AI for analytics and content strategy. The chatbot can examine post performance metrics including reach, engagement indicators, and interaction patterns to recommend content approaches. It can also aggregate data from business accounts and internet sources to construct presentations, documents, and spreadsheets, as well as handle automated functions such as generating routine analytics reports.
